12 Lisbon Beach Hostels – shared dorms and private rooms

If you are in Lisbon on a budget and want to be near the beach, here are 12 hostels on beaches near Lisbon, at Carcavelos Beach, Estoril, and the beautiful Costa da Caparica.  Prices start at $15 per night.

Carcavelos Surf Hostel

Carcavelos Surf Hostel is a two-story house with room for 22 guests.

They have dorms for 2 to 6 people, as well as private rooms. The hostel is two blocks from the beach and two blocks from the Lisbon Surf Camp. 

Private rooms are going for €40 per night, and dorms are €15 per night.

They offer surf packages as well.

During the high season, two lessons, and a two-night stay with breakfast is €240.

The beginner surf package is five nights, five breakfasts, one dinner, and three surf lessons for €500.

They also offer a weeklong beginner surf package which includes lodging for seven nights, seven breakfasts, dinner barbecue, and five surf lessons for €740.

The hostel has a 1000 square meter garden with a pool and barbecue, and a terrace with views of the ocean.

Terrace Beach House

Terrace Beach House has one large 6 person dorm, one twin room, two private rooms with a double bed, and two large family rooms.  The living room features a PlayStation, and the third floor is a terrace where you can practice yoga or check out the sunset.

The hostel is 150 yards from the beach, 200 yards from the grocery store, where are you can purchase food to cook in their large kitchen.

The shared family room with a shared bathroom is $98.

The twin bed private room with a shared bath is also $98  breakfast is included in the price.

How to get to Lisbon’s beach hostels

In order to get from the Lisbon Airport to any of the hostels in Estoril, or Cascais, take the metro from the airport. 

You can buy a Metro Viva Viagem card and put a cash balance on the card. 

Switch to the metro green line at Alameda Station, and head to Cais de Sodré. 

At Cais de Sodré, switch to the Comboios train toward Cascais. 

Cascais is the last stop. 

The Comboios train costs €2. 

This can be deducted from the Viva Viagem card.

In order to get from the Lisbon Airport to any of the hostels in Costa da Caparica, take the metro from the airport. 

Switch to the metro green line at Alameda Station, and head to Cais de Sodré. 

At Cais de Sodré, switch to the ferry 

The ferry costs €1.25. 

On the other side of the river, the ferry docks at the TST bus terminal in Cacilhas.

The ferry can also be paid out of your Viva Viagem card.

At the back of the lot, you will find TST bus 135 (20 minutes to beach) and bus 124 (40 minutes to same beach). 

Pay cash for the ticket €2.40. Viva Viagem card is not accepted by TST.
